Hi

I crossflashed a Netgear router to a bigger model and I'm going to solder in an usb port that this smaller model did not have, there are 3 components missing and 2 of them has silkscreen designator B2 and B3 - anyone know what this components are supposed to be ?

The missing cap C195 I found out is a 16V 100 microfarad.

They are ferrite beads. You can just put 0 Ohm resistors or jumpers there.
